3. Radon detection
Radon detection is a important, usually legally mandated, part of evaluations of atmospheric composition in New Jersey. Radon, a colorless and odorless radioactive fuel, originates from the pure decay of uranium in soil and rock. It could actually infiltrate buildings by cracks in foundations and different entry factors, accumulating to harmful ranges indoors. As a result of radon is undetectable with out specialised gear, focused detection strategies are important to make sure a protected atmosphere.
The importance of radon detection stems from its direct influence on human well being. Extended publicity to elevated radon ranges will increase the danger of lung most cancers, making it a number one explanation for most cancers deaths amongst non-smokers. Consequently, many actual property transactions in New Jersey require radon evaluations to guard potential householders. Moreover, the New Jersey Division of Environmental Safety (NJDEP) gives assets and tips to help residents in understanding and mitigating radon dangers, together with lists of licensed radon measurement professionals.

6. Asbestos screening
Asbestos screening represents a specialised subset of air high quality testing in New Jersey, centered on figuring out and quantifying airborne asbestos fibers. Its relevance stems from the documented well being dangers related to asbestos publicity, necessitating particular protocols and analytical methods distinct from these employed for normal air high quality assessments.
-
Historic Context and Regulatory Framework
Previous to its regulation, asbestos was broadly utilized in development supplies, posing ongoing dangers as these supplies age and deteriorate. Federal and state rules mandate asbestos screening in particular conditions, corresponding to constructing renovations or demolitions, to stop uncontrolled launch of fibers. Failure to adjust to these rules may end up in substantial penalties and authorized liabilities.
-
Sampling Methodologies and Analytical Strategies
Asbestos screening makes use of specialised sampling strategies to gather airborne particles, sometimes involving high-volume air samplers with particular filter sorts. The collected samples are then analyzed utilizing microscopy methods, corresponding to part distinction microscopy (PCM) or transmission electron microscopy (TEM), to determine and quantify asbestos fibers. TEM gives extra definitive identification of asbestos fiber sorts in comparison with PCM.
-
Publicity Evaluation and Threat Mitigation
The outcomes of asbestos screening are used to evaluate potential publicity ranges and inform danger mitigation methods. If asbestos fibers are detected above regulatory limits, abatement measures, corresponding to removing or encapsulation of asbestos-containing supplies, are required to guard constructing occupants and employees. The effectiveness of abatement measures is verified by post-abatement screening.
-
Limitations and Complementary Testing
Asbestos screening particularly targets airborne asbestos fibers and doesn’t present a complete evaluation of general air high quality. Complementary air high quality testing could also be crucial to guage different potential contaminants, corresponding to mould, VOCs, or particulate matter. Moreover, asbestos screening outcomes characterize circumstances on the time of sampling and should not replicate long-term publicity dangers.

7. Allowing necessities
Allowing necessities act as a main driver for air high quality evaluations in New Jersey. Quite a few industrial and business actions necessitate permits from the New Jersey Division of Environmental Safety (NJDEP) previous to operation. These permits usually stipulate particular standards for atmospheric emissions, together with limits on pollution and obligatory schedules for air high quality testing. Consequently, the authorized obligation to acquire and keep permits straight compels many organizations to interact in routine evaluation of their emissions and their influence on the encircling environment. For instance, a brand new energy plant searching for to function inside the state should first safe an air allow, which is able to define the required testing protocols and emission thresholds that the plant should repeatedly meet and reveal by common atmospheric evaluations.
The connection between allowing and evaluations is inherently intertwined: allowing rules set up the appropriate parameters for atmospheric emissions, whereas evaluations present the empirical information to verify compliance. With out rigorous evaluation, it turns into not possible to reveal adherence to allow circumstances. Think about the case of a producing facility utilizing processes that launch unstable natural compounds. Its working allow will possible specify most allowable emission charges for these compounds. To reveal compliance, the ability should conduct common stack testing, a type of analysis, to measure the precise emissions and examine them in opposition to the allow limits. Failure to reveal compliance may end up in fines, allow revocation, and authorized motion, reinforcing the sensible significance of evaluation inside the allowing framework.
